Factory expansion boosts Severn Glocon
15 Jan 2000
As the first birthday of the merger of Severn Glocon approaches, the company continues to build on its combined 40 years in the design and manufacture of process control valves and actuators (see stand C34).
The Gloucester site has been increased in size to produce some 4000 valves per year. The products have been integrated, resulting in a more comprehensive range. Severn Glocon can also design and manufacture to customer specifications.
The company is continuing to develop aftercare services. Its three workshops have been extended, and provide site/valve service requirements with on site and off site overhauls.
* Severn Glocon has recently completed an order to the Middle East, including a 16in Globe valve with a new anti-cavitation trim
